Output d6d6b8604b985d97cbe853084f47fd92c8b371eb68a0f920566ecb4e428241e4:24

value
153014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d56450b8473fc8dba7260a2a2f43acc66a9e78 OP_EQUAL
address
3LN5QQLvmLxyUECg1SkTFQeyzsgrQJqZdv
transaction
d6d6b8604b985d97cbe853084f47fd92c8b371eb68a0f920566ecb4e428241e4
confirmations
114950
spent
true